    Grant Scott Bonham Fetal Center

    In 2022, Intermountain Primary Children’s Hospital dedicated and opened the Grant Scott Bonham Fetal Center. Grant, the second of four children born to Brad and Megan Bonham, passed away shortly after birth due to an inoperable kidney condition. In his memory, the center was established to advance life-saving fetal care.

    Since opening, the Grant Scott Bonham Fetal Center has saved dozens of lives through in-utero surgeries that correct life-threatening conditions. The center is led by Dr. Fenton and a highly skilled team of compassionate medical professionals committed to giving families hope when they need it most.

    Ronald McDonald House Charities

    The Ronald McDonald House provides a home away from home for families of pediatric patients receiving treatment at Salt Lake City’s world-class hospital programs serving the Intermountain region and beyond.

    The House offers comfortable lodging, shuttle transportation to and from select area hospitals, daily meals and snacks, access to a beautiful backyard park, and tickets to community attractions and events when available. All services are provided free of charge, made possible through the generosity of community partners and dedicated donors who ensure families can focus on what matters most—their child’s care and healing.

    Pro Life Utah

    Pro-Life Utah has served more than 650 women across the state, offering compassionate, no-cost support during some of life’s most difficult moments. Through free pregnancy testing, ultrasounds, and individualized options counseling, the organization provides women with clear information and meaningful resources to help them make informed decisions.

    Beyond medical services, Pro-Life Utah offers Life Grants to assist expectant mothers with expenses associated with carrying and delivering their babies, helping ease financial burdens during pregnancy. By combining practical assistance with emotional support, Pro-Life Utah works to ensure that women feel empowered, supported, and cared for as they choose life for their children.

    Utah Foster Care

    Since 1999, Utah Foster Care has implemented transforamtive strategies to recruit, educate, and support foster families throughout the state of Utah. Working under contract with Utah’s Division of Child and Family Services (DCFS) and in partnership with numerous community organizations, Utah Foster Care plays a critical role in strengthening Utah’s child welfare system.

    Since its founding, the organization has recruited and trained more than 16,650 families to provide safe, stable, and nurturing homes for children who must spend time in out-of-home care while they work toward reunification with their families or transition into permanent adoptive placements.
